Staples - Computers & Printing
Staples - Computers & Printing stores & openning hours in Dallas
Staples - Computers & Printing - Dallas
4351 Dallas Fort Worth Tpke, Ste 200, Dallas, TX 75212
Staples - Computers & Printing locations & hours near Dallas
21 miles
Staples - Computers & Printing - North Richland Hills
6201 Ne Loop 820, North Richland Hills, TX 76180